People such as doctors, dentists, veterinarians, lawyers, accountants, contractors, subcontractors, public stenographers, or auctioneers who are in an independent trade, business, or profession in which they offer their services to the general public are generally independent contractors.

There are many situations in which a business will want to engage the services of an independent contractor instead of hiring an employee. In these situations, both parties must sign an independent contractor agreement.

New York does not require most contractors to hold a license on the state level.

An independent contractor agreement is a contract that lays out the terms of the independent contractor's work. It covers the contractual obligations, scope, and deadlines of the work to be performed. It affirms that the client and contractor are not in an employer-employee relationship.

An Independent Contractor Agreement is a contract between a company and an independent contractor to hire the contractor without them becoming an employee. In this agreement, the contractor or freelancer agrees to work for the hiring organization for a specified period of time, on a specific assignment or project.

Write the contract in six steps Start with a contract template. Open with the basic information. Describe in detail what you have agreed to. Include a description of how the contract will be ended. Write into the contract which laws apply and how disputes will be resolved. Include space for signatures.

A contract is an essential legal component of establishing a consultant-client relationship. You should always make sure a signed contract is in place before starting any work. A contract will define the relationship between you and your client, clearly stating that you are an independent contractor.

Independent contractor agreements may be per-project with an agreed upon deadline and date until which the contract is valid, or they may be ongoing, until one party terminates the agreement.

Many independent contractor agreements have termination provisions which describe under what conditions the agreement can be terminated by either the Company or the independent contractor. These independent contractor termination provisions should be strictly followed to avoid breach of contract lawsuits.
